The Swiss diesel trucks market (weighing less than 5 tonnes) showed fluctuating trends between 2012 and 2022. The period began with steady growth but witnessed a few dips, most notably in 2013 (-5.26%) and 2016 (-7.88%). Despite these downturns, the market rebounded significantly, especially after the sharp decline in 2020 (-16.32%), marking a robust recovery in 2021 (16.63%) and continued growth into 2022 (7.19%). Over the last five years, the market's compound annual growth rate (CAGR) stands at 3.62%, indicating a moderate but consistent upward trend.
